Maybe not quite as popular as shows from the UK or USA, Canada has produced some classic television. Charming programs with fantastic casts and excellent writing. YouTube Channel Encore+ is working with several Canadian production and distribution companies to preserve some popular titles, making them freely available to all who want to watch. Personally, I’m excited to see an easy way to stream Slings & Arrows, since the wife and I are Shakespeare nerds, and this show is one of the truest (and funniest) representations of a life spent in theatre.
Other classics include Are You Afraid of the Dark, Due South, and Degrassi. Conveniently organized in playlists by show, Encore+ promises more to come. Shocking to see under 6000 subscribers at the time this post was written. Check out the link below for some excellent (and free) TV watching.
The Kodak Pixpro team has been well ahead of the curve for panorama and 360° video. The Orbit 360 is their first All-in-One camera solution for truly spherical photos and videos. It does feature an interesting design that I haven’t played with before. It’s the most flexible action camera I’ve ever used, but does that justify the price tag?
